excel如何把文字和数字分开(Excel文字数字分离)
作者:路由通
|

发布时间:2025-06-08 13:46:43
标签:
Excel文字与数字分离的深度解析 在数据处理中,Excel的文字与数字分离是常见需求,涉及从混合文本中提取有效信息。无论是产品编码、地址记录还是财务数据,高效拆分能显著提升工作效率。传统方法包括手动分列、公式函数或VBA脚本,但随着数据

<>
Excel文字与数字分离的深度解析
在数据处理中,Excel的文字与数字分离是常见需求,涉及从混合文本中提取有效信息。无论是产品编码、地址记录还是财务数据,高效拆分能显著提升工作效率。传统方法包括手动分列、公式函数或VBA脚本,但随着数据复杂度增加,需结合多种技术手段。不同场景下对精度和速度的要求差异较大,例如批量处理时需考虑自动化方案,而临时调整可能依赖内置工具。本文将系统性地从函数应用、分列功能、正则表达式等八个维度展开,对比各方案优劣并提供实操案例。
实际应用中需注意:当文本包含特殊符号(如连字符)时,需调整查找逻辑。例如处理"ID-1001"时,可先定位分隔符位置再拆分。
此功能对日期格式敏感,若数字部分类似日期(如"2023-12"),可能被错误识别为日期值而非文本。
注意:当文本中存在连续分隔符时,会生成空列,需勾选"连续分隔符视为单个处理"选项。
对于包含非拉丁字符(如中文数字"一百二十三")的情况,需先进行文本标准化处理。
注意:VBA安全设置可能阻止宏运行,需调整信任中心设置或对文档进行数字签名。
建议配合LET函数定义中间变量提升可读性,例如:=LET(t,A1,n,SEQUENCE(LEN(t)),TEXTJOIN("",1,IF(ISNUMBER(MID(t,n,1)1),"",MID(t,n,1))))
此方法适合作为其他拆分技术的补充验证手段。
安装前需注意:部分企业IT策略可能限制插件安装,且大版本更新时可能存在兼容性问题。
>
Excel文字与数字分离的深度解析
在数据处理中,Excel的文字与数字分离是常见需求,涉及从混合文本中提取有效信息。无论是产品编码、地址记录还是财务数据,高效拆分能显著提升工作效率。传统方法包括手动分列、公式函数或VBA脚本,但随着数据复杂度增加,需结合多种技术手段。不同场景下对精度和速度的要求差异较大,例如批量处理时需考虑自动化方案,而临时调整可能依赖内置工具。本文将系统性地从函数应用、分列功能、正则表达式等八个维度展开,对比各方案优劣并提供实操案例。
一、基础文本函数拆分法
Excel的LEFT、RIGHT和MID函数是最基础的文本处理工具。LEFT函数可从左侧开始提取指定字符数,适合固定格式的数据。例如处理"ABC123"时,=LEFT(A1,3)可提取"ABC"。但若数字部分长度不固定(如"A1"和"AB100"),需配合LEN和FIND函数动态定位。以下是三种常见组合公式对比:函数组合 | 适用场景 | 局限性 |
---|---|---|
=LEFT(A1,FIND(1,A1)-1) | 数字以1开头 | 依赖特定数字起始 |
=MID(A1,MIN(FIND(0,1,2,3,4,5,6,7,8,9,A1&"0123456789")),LEN(A1)) | 通用数字提取 | 数组公式需Ctrl+Shift+Enter |
=REPLACE(A1,1,SUMPRODUCT(--ISERR(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1)+0)),"") | 提取纯数字部分 | 计算效率较低 |
二、Flash Fill智能填充功能
Excel 2013及以上版本引入的Flash Fill能自动识别模式并完成拆分。在输入1-2个示例后,按Ctrl+E触发该功能。其优势在于无需编写公式,但对数据规律性要求较高。- 操作步骤:
- 在相邻列手动输入首个拆分结果
- 按下Ctrl+E自动填充后续行
- 右键菜单可调整匹配模式
- 典型应用场景对比:
数据类型 | 成功率 | 修正方法 |
---|---|---|
固定长度编码(如AA1234) | 95% | 无需修正 |
变长地址(如"北京101号") | 60% | 需补充3-5个示例 |
混合符号(如"订单2024X") | 40% | 建议改用公式 |
三、文本分列向导工具
数据选项卡中的文本分列向导提供可视化拆分界面,支持按分隔符或固定宽度分列。处理包含统一分隔符(如空格、逗号)的数据时效率最高。关键操作节点:- 选择"分隔符号"时,可同时勾选多个符号(如逗号和分号)
- 固定宽度模式下,通过点击标尺设置分列线
- 第三步可单独设置每列的数据格式
分隔符类型 | 处理速度(万行/s) | 错误率 |
---|---|---|
Tab键 | 8.2 | 0.01% |
分号 | 7.5 | 0.3% |
自定义符号(如) | 6.8 | 1.2% |
四、Power Query高级拆分
Power Query提供更强大的文本处理能力,特别适合需要清洗的复杂数据。通过"按字符类型拆分列"功能,可一键分离字母与数字。典型处理流程:- 数据导入后选择"拆分列"→"按字符类型"
- 选择"字母"和"数字"作为拆分依据
- 在高级选项中设置保留原始列
比较项 | Power Query | Excel公式 |
---|---|---|
处理10万行耗时 | 12秒 | 45秒 |
内存占用 | 320MB | 780MB |
后续更新便捷性 | 刷新即可 | 需拖动公式 |
五、正则表达式解决方案
通过VBA调用正则表达式可实现最灵活的文本匹配。需在VBA编辑器中添加Microsoft VBScript Regular Expressions引用。常用正则模式示例:- 提取数字:d+
- 提取字母:[A-Za-z]+
- 排除符号:[^Wd_]+
方法 | 复杂模式支持 | 执行速度(次/ms) |
---|---|---|
正则表达式 | 支持前瞻等高级语法 | 850 |
原生函数组合 | 仅基础匹配 | 1200 |
循环遍历字符 | 可自定义逻辑 | 400 |
六、动态数组公式应用
Office 365新增的动态数组函数如TEXTSPLIT、TEXTJOIN等,可构建更简洁的拆分方案。例如:=TEXTSPLIT(A1,CHAR(SEQUENCE(10,,48)))将按所有数字字符拆分文本对比传统数组公式:特性 | 动态数组 | 传统数组 |
---|---|---|
溢出范围 | 自动扩展 | 需预先选择区域 |
计算逻辑 | 链式引用 | 独立计算 |
版本兼容性 | 仅365/2021 | 全版本支持 |
七、条件格式辅助识别
通过条件格式标记数字或文本部分,可辅助人工校验拆分结果。创建基于公式的规则:- 标记数字:=ISNUMBER(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1)1)
- 标记字母:=AND(CODE(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1))>64,CODE(MID(A1,ROW(INDIRECT("1:"&LEN(A1))),1))<123)
标记方法 | 可视效果 | 计算负担 |
---|---|---|
单元格级 | 精确到字符 | 高 |
行级 | 整行统一 | 低 |
列级 | 快速识别列类型 | 最低 |
八、第三方插件扩展方案
如Kutools等插件提供一键分离功能,通常整合在"文本处理"菜单中。优势在于封装复杂操作,但可能产生额外成本。主流插件功能对比:插件名称 | 分离算法 | 批处理能力 |
---|---|---|
Kutools | 基于模式识别 | 支持文件夹批量处理 |
ASAP Utilities | 规则引擎驱动 | 仅活动工作表 |
PowerTools | 机器学习模型 | 云服务集成 |

在数据治理实践中,往往需要组合多种技术手段。例如先用Flash Fill快速处理80%规范数据,再通过Power Query清洗剩余异常值。对于开发人员,VBA方案提供最大灵活性,而业务用户可能更倾向分列向导的易用性。随着Excel功能迭代,动态数组正在改变传统数据处理范式,但版本碎片化仍是企业部署的挑战。理解每种方法的适用边界,才能构建高效的数据预处理流水线。值得注意的是,中文等双字节语言的处理需要额外考虑字符编码问题,这在全球化数据环境中尤为关键。
>
相关文章
Windows 10与Windows 7作为微软主流操作系统,在共享打印机功能上存在显著差异。两者虽均支持基础打印共享,但在实现机制、驱动兼容性、网络协议支持及安全策略等方面呈现代际差异。Windows 10凭借原生支持SMB 3.0协议、
2025-06-08 13:46:37

微信视频发不出去怎么办?全方位解决方案 微信作为国内最大的社交平台之一,视频功能已成为用户日常沟通的重要工具。然而,许多用户在使用过程中经常遇到视频发送失败的问题,这不仅影响了用户体验,还可能耽误重要信息的传递。视频发送失败的原因多种多样
2025-06-08 13:46:01

微信订阅号关闭全方位指南 在当今信息爆炸的时代,微信订阅号作为内容传播的重要渠道,既为用户提供了丰富资讯,也可能因信息过载带来困扰。许多用户出于个人需求或账号管理考虑,需要关闭或调整订阅号功能。本文将从八个维度深入解析微信订阅号的关闭方法
2025-06-08 13:46:00

新卡开通微信全攻略 综合评述 在数字化支付时代,微信支付已成为日常生活的重要组成部分。新办理的手机卡如何成功绑定微信账号,涉及运营商合规性、实名认证流程、风控策略等多重因素。本文将从运营商选择、实名认证匹配度、设备环境适配等八个维度,系统
2025-06-08 13:45:55

抖音全方位玩法深度解析 在当今社交媒体爆炸式发展的时代,抖音作为短视频领域的领军平台,已成为内容创作者和品牌营销的重要阵地。玩转抖音不仅需要创意和技巧,更需要系统化的运营策略。从账号定位到内容创作,从算法理解到商业化变现,每个环节都蕴含着
2025-06-08 13:45:51

抖音视频号运营全方位深度解析 抖音视频号作为短视频生态的核心阵地,其运营逻辑既遵循平台算法规则,又需结合内容创作与用户互动的双重特性。成功的视频号运营需要系统化的策略布局,从账号定位、内容生产到流量转化形成完整闭环。与图文平台不同,抖音的
2025-06-08 13:45:52

热门推荐